How I Would Use It in My Routine

In my routine, I would use this serum after cleansing and before moisturizing. I would also make sure to wear sunscreen during the day, since discoloration treatments work best when paired with sun protection. For me, consistency would matter more than using too much product at once.

What I Would Expect Over Time

I would not expect instant results from a product like this. In my experience, discoloration treatments usually need patience and regular use. I would look for gradual improvement in the appearance of dark spots, a more even complexion, and a brighter overall look.
